SA20 Final in Cape Town, Playoffs Across Three Cities

The stage is set for an electrifying season of the SA20 2025-26, with the opening clash and the grand finale both scheduled to take place at Cape Town’s iconic Newlands. The competition begins on December 26, a date cricket fans look forward to as it blends festive celebrations with world-class T20 action. Defending champions MI Cape Town will kick off the season against the formidable Durban Super Giants, setting the tone for a high-octane tournament.

The final showdown will be held on January 25, marking the culmination of a season filled with thrilling contests, passionate fans, and a festive cricketing atmosphere. Alongside Cape Town, Durban, Centurion, and Johannesburg will play pivotal roles as playoff hosts, making this edition one of the most geographically diverse in the tournament’s history.

Playoffs Across Three Cities

Durban’s First-Ever Playoff

Durban makes history this season by hosting a playoff for the very first time. The Qualifier 1, scheduled for January 21, will feature the tournament’s top two teams. This development is expected to generate tremendous buzz among fans in Durban, offering them a chance to witness two of the competition’s finest sides battling for a direct spot in the final.

Eliminator in Centurion

Centurion takes center stage on January 23, hosting the crucial Eliminator. Here, the third and fourth-placed teams will fight for survival, with the winner progressing to the next stage. Known for its lively pitch and evening crowd, Centurion promises an electrifying encounter filled with drama and high-pressure cricket.

Johannesburg Set for Qualifier 2

The journey continues to Johannesburg’s Wanderers Stadium on January 24, where Qualifier 2 will be contested. The stakes will be monumental, as the winner secures the last ticket to the final. With matches scheduled closely together, the Wanderers’ vibrant Friday-night atmosphere is set to make this fixture a must-watch for fans across the country.

Auction to Finalize Squads

Key Date for Teams

While fans are already buzzing about fixtures, teams have their eyes on another crucial milestone: the player auction on September 9. This event will finalize the 19-player squads for each franchise, shaping strategies and squad depth for the season.

A Look Back at Previous Champions

Sunrisers Eastern Cape’s Dominance

The first two editions of SA20 were ruled by Sunrisers Eastern Cape, who showcased remarkable consistency and tactical brilliance. Their dominance established them as the benchmark team of the competition’s early years.

MI Cape Town’s Breakthrough Win

However, last season shifted the balance of power. MI Cape Town clinched their maiden SA20 title by defeating Sunrisers Eastern Cape in a gripping final. Their triumph not only boosted the franchise’s reputation but also set up a compelling rivalry that fans will be eager to follow this year.
